Output d58b210ecc684881a4ad437c6a23aa60921e4fd86fb3ec2bcb5cfc1af3166500:43

value
552690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b2d30da9452b45eaadf2a39687f739d484229c0 OP_EQUAL
address
3FqWoC5JAcWPzxsWJEuLXiHRUqRtN6C7Pe
transaction
d58b210ecc684881a4ad437c6a23aa60921e4fd86fb3ec2bcb5cfc1af3166500
spent
true